Expand Map
Video Games in Ivalee, AL
1. GameStop
2. Redbox
315 3rd St NW, Attalla, AL 35954
3. EB Games
300 E Meighan Blvd, Gadsden, AL 35903
4. Replays
108 E Meighan Blvd, Gadsden, AL 35903
CLOSED NOW:10:00 am - 9:00 pm
"I am not sure why I haven't written a review before now. I guess since I am there all the time it doesn't seem like something new so i never thought of it. Replays is my…"
19 Years
in Business
Amenities:
Wheelchair accessible
Showing 1-5 of 5